We arrived in Istanbul last week. It's the biggest city in Turkey, nearly 20 million people live in there. There are a lot of cars on the street all the time. First we went to Topkapi Palace. It was built 600 years ago and Ottoman Sultans lived here. It was so old and historic. After that we went to Dolmabahce Palace. The founder of Turkey stayed in Dolmabahce, he was Mustafa Kemal Ataturk. He was the biggest leader for the Turkish people. Everybody liked him. Also we saw the room where Ataturk died. In this room the clock stopped at 9.05 and Ataturk died at 9.05 in 1938. It was interesting story. At night we went to Sultanahmet and we ate special beef. It is called kofte. Also we saw the biggest mosque in Sultanahmet and we listened to prayer. On the next day we went back to England.
